Hijos Dorados is the debut novel by Patricia Ibárcena, released in November 2024 by Umbriel. It is a Dark Academia thriller that explores the cutthroat environment of elite legal education. Plot Summary

The story follows Vera Velasco, an ambitious student from Peru who moves to the United States to attend the prestigious Cornell Law School. Her goal is singular: to secure one of only four available scholarships, a feat that requires her to be the absolute best in her class.

Despite warnings to stay away, Vera becomes fascinated by a group known as the "golden children" (hijos dorados)—Roman, Blythe, Charles, and Connor. This elite clique is composed of brilliant, wealthy, and dangerous students from influential families who will stop at nothing to maintain their power. As Vera is drawn into their circle, she discovers a dark world of:

Betrayal and Secrets: The lines between friendship and rivalry blur as alliances shift constantly.

Moral Ambiguity: The novel asks how far one is willing to go for power and success.

Hijos Dorados (Golden Children) is a popular dark academia novel by Patricia Ibárcena, released on October 24, 2024, by Umbriel. The Story

The plot centers on Vera Velasco, a brilliant student at the prestigious Cornell University School of Law. In an environment where being exceptional isn't enough, Vera is determined to secure one of the four coveted scholarships. Her plan is to work tirelessly, but she soon finds herself entangled with a group of wealthy, influential students.

The novel explores the lengths individuals will go to for power and status, set against a backdrop of mystery and intense academic competition. Themes include:

Power Dynamics: The divide between the elite and those striving to join them.

Toxic Relationships: Readers often describe the character dynamics as complex and sometimes "toxic" due to the extreme pressures and moral ambiguities.
